The Taapsee Pannu and Diljit Dosanjh-starrer Soorma might have gotten off to a slow start, but business has been steady with the film raking in Rs 17.79 crore in five days. The Sandeep Singh biopic produced by Chitrangada Singh has held its own against the juggernaut that’s Sanju.

On day 1, Soorma raked in Rs 3.25 crore.

It is Diljit Dosanjh’s regional stardom that is drawing the audience to cinema houses in the northern parts of the country. The singer-actor has previously been celebrated for his roles in Udta Punjab and Phillauri.

A biopic, Soorma, starring Diljit Dosanjh as Sandeep Singh, tells the story of an impossible feat. The film tells the story of East Indian field hockey player Sandeep Singh who made a comeback after a gunshot wound left him bound to a wheelchair.
